Effective January 18, 2022 it will be even easier to travel to Aruba!

To help ensure the safety and well-being of all residents and visitors, the Government of Aruba continually assesses the overall environment related to COVID-19 and modifies a variety of health and safety protocols, as appropriate. 

Effective January 18, 2022 it will be even easier to travel to Aruba! Continue reading to learn the details about

  • Antigen tests are now accepted, details below
  • Recently recovered? Read how you can now travel as soon as 10 days after your positive test

 

The following information reflects the most up-to-date information as it pertains to Aruba’s reopening protocols and procedures. Aruba’s health and safety protocols will be revisited and reevaluated on an ongoing basis. Based on the ever-changing situation, the Government of Aruba recommends all visitors check Aruba.com frequently for any changes to dates, markets, required procedures and more.

This information is subject to change at the discretion of the Government of Aruba.
